Don’t leap into make-up instantly after skincare
Being in a rush and having your make-up final are usually not reconcilable, particularly in relation to timing your make-up utility to your skincare. It’s an absolute should to place some area between the final step in your skin-care routine and step one of your make-up routine. “It’s finest to let your skincare dry down a little bit bit earlier than transferring on to make-up,” says Patinkin. Hughes agrees, telling Attract you must wait 5 to seven minutes, “then go on with a complexion product.”
You’ll comprehend it’s time when your pores and skin doesn’t really feel slick anymore. “I’ve dry pores and skin, so I prefer to go in with a thicker moisturizer,” Rodriguez says. “Once I can faucet my cheek, and it is now not moist—simply bouncy—that is once I know I am prepared for make-up.”
Use as little product as attainable
Is “much less is extra” a cliché? Sure. Is that as a result of it’s true? Additionally, sure, particularly in relation to make-up and the skincare you’re making use of earlier than it. “Do not overdo skincare as a result of an excessive amount of is detrimental to your make-up,” Hughes says.
Our professionals unanimously agree. Rodriguez says resist the urge to do a full “12-step Korean skincare routine” earlier than beginning your make-up. “You are making a little bit mess.” As an alternative, they are saying, use minimal product all the best way as much as your powder.
Patinkin at all times tells her purchasers, the thinner the layer, the longer the wear and tear. “Undoubtedly use a lightweight hand, apply as little product as you may get away with, and also you don’t have to use make-up on each floor of your face—particularly these areas which can be susceptible to getting sweaty, like the perimeters of the nostril and the higher lip.”
